Transaction a4d63194cb4a5fe83e7543b84b99a24c9c7916660d0babf81fa0730dbf7e5279

1 Input
1 Outputs
  • a4d63194cb4a5fe83e7543b84b99a24c9c7916660d0babf81fa0730dbf7e5279:0
  • value  25567703
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G